Neutral node autotransformers

The sudden loss of neutral is a potential hazard for an installation.

Loss of neutral can occur if the neutral is cut during a repair in the network, during a public project or even by some unforeseen factor such as the destruction of a power pole by a falling tree, etc.

Under certain conditions, the loss of neutral can lead to the supply of an installation with 380 – 400 Volts per phase instead of 230 with unpredictable results. There are ways on the market to provide for the immediate interruption of the supply in the event of a loss of neutral, but such protection will leave you without power until someone repairs the problem.
